KEY FACTORS

Factors that Affect Parker Car Shipping Costs

Distance

Parker's location in Douglas County, approximately 25-40 miles southeast of Denver, positions it well for regional and long-distance shipping. Longer distances naturally increase fuel costs and driver time, so shipping to the coasts or cross-country will cost more than regional moves within Colorado or neighboring states. Our AI-verified pricing accounts for exact mileage to provide transparent, assignment-ready quotes that carriers actually accept.

Season

Colorado winters (November-March) bring snow and icy conditions to Parker, which increases shipping costs due to slower travel speeds, additional driver caution, and higher fuel consumption. Summer months (May-September) see peak demand for car shipping nationwide, often resulting in higher rates despite ideal weather conditions. Spring and fall typically offer the best balance of reasonable pricing and reliable delivery windows in the Parker area.

Route

Most shipments to/from Parker utilize I-25 northbound to Denver or I-270 eastbound, with some routes taking I-76 toward the northeastern plains. These major corridors are generally well-maintained but can experience congestion during peak hours, potentially affecting delivery timelines and carrier routing decisions. Direct highway access via I-25 actually works in your favor—it keeps routes predictable and helps us secure competitive pricing from our network of FMCSA-licensed carriers.

Vehicle Type

Compact sedans and standard passenger vehicles are the most economical to ship from Parker, while oversized vehicles like trucks, SUVs, and luxury cars require additional space on carriers or specialized equipment, raising costs accordingly. Classic and high-value vehicles may benefit from enclosed transport options, which provide extra protection but at a premium price. Tips & Tricks for Saving on Vehicle Shipping

1

Off Season Savings

Late spring through early summer (May-June) offers the lowest rates for Parker shipping, as demand drops after winter relocations and before peak summer travel season. Colorado's harsh winters (November-March) drive up costs due to weather delays on I-25 and mountain passes, so booking your shipment for mild-weather months can save 15-25% on average rates.

2

Flexible pickup & delivery

If you can accept a 5-10 day delivery window instead of a specific date, you'll unlock significantly lower quotes—carriers can batch Parker pickups with nearby Denver metro shipments for better route efficiency. This flexibility is especially valuable during busy seasons when rigid deadlines command premium pricing.

3

Hub city advantages

Parker's location along the I-25 corridor between Denver and Colorado Springs makes it a natural routing point for carriers, which increases competition and keeps rates competitive compared to remote mountain towns. 4

Weather considerations

Winter shipping from Parker (November-March) carries higher costs and delays due to snow on I-25 and mountain passes, so scheduling for spring or fall transit saves money and guarantees faster delivery. 6

Open carrier transport

Choosing an open trailer instead of enclosed can save 20-35% on Parker shipments, since your vehicle shares hauling space with multiple cars and requires no climate protection. Open transport works perfectly for standard vehicles being shipped locally or regionally through Colorado's dry climate.

7

Flexible dates

Giving carriers a 2-3 week window to pick up or deliver your car from Parker allows them to optimize routes along I-25 and consolidate loads with other regional shipments. This scheduling flexibility directly reduces your cost since carriers pass along savings from efficient multi-stop routes.

Moving Insights

Things to Know About Moving to/from Parker

Professional auto transport service for Parker moves

Colorado vehicle registration requires proof of ownership, a valid ID, and proof of insurance before you can register your vehicle with the state [DMV]. When shipping a car to Parker, ensure you have the necessary documents needed to ship a car ready for the handoff. Colorado also mandates emissions testing for most vehicles, so plan accordingly if relocating to the Denver metro area [DMV].

Parker-specific considerations include residential parking regulations in certain neighborhoods and speed limits that vary by zone [City Website]. Winter weather is critical for Parker drivers—snow tires or all-season tires with adequate tread are essential from October through April [Colorado State Patrol]. Window tinting must allow at least 27% light transmission on front windows [DMV]. Colorado requires minimum liability insurance of 25/50/15, but higher coverage is recommended given mountain driving conditions [Colorado Division of Insurance]. When planning auto transport to or from Parker, account for seasonal weather impacts on delivery timelines and ensure your vehicle has proper winterization before arrival.

See our Vehicle Shipping Tips for more details about how to prepare your vehicle for shipping. In short, you'll want to remove any toll pass or fragile items, make sure you have a key available to provide the carrier, and remove any interior and exterior accessories that could be damaged in transit. Since Parker experiences Colorado's variable weather, we also recommend ensuring your vehicle's battery is in good condition and fuel tank is no more than a quarter full before pickup.

Yes, your vehicle is fully insured when shipping to or from Parker, CO. All carriers we work with are FMCSA-licensed and required to carry a minimum of $1,000,000 in liability insurance and $100,000 in cargo insurance. We verify that each carrier's insurance policy is valid and in good standing throughout your shipment, so you can have peace of mind knowing your vehicle is protected during transport to Parker.

Your shipment with SAKAEM includes up to 100 lbs of personal items or household goods stored in the trunk area or secured below the window line. If your shipment includes ocean transit (Hawaii shipments), your vehicle must be emptied of all items. SAKAEM and your assigned carrier are not responsible for personal items left inside your vehicle. See our Auto Transport Process Article for more details.

A designated (adult) must be present at pickup and delivery. This designated person plays an important role in the shipping process including documenting the state of the vehicle and signing the Bill of Lading, which acts as a receipt of the vehicle's condition.

Enclosed transport costs at least 50% more than open trailers, but it's the right choice for high-value vehicles like classics or custom-painted cars that need protection from road debris. In the Parker area, where weather can shift quickly and highways see heavy traffic, enclosed transport shields your vehicle from Colorado's elements and unexpected road hazards. We transport sedans, SUVs, pickup trucks, electric vehicles, vans and motorcycles across all 48 continental states + Hawaii. Our services even provide shipment for golf carts, ATVs, or RVs. We can ship vehicles that don't run so long as the vehicle can roll, brake, and steer, and that you can provide the carrier with a key to the vehicle. The only exception is boats, which we do not transport.

Car Shipping 101

How Auto Transport Works

Car shipping in Parker, CO doesn't have to be complicated. Whether you're moving to Florida, California, or anywhere in between, understanding the auto transport process helps you make informed decisions. This guide breaks down how car shipping works from start to finish, so you know exactly what to expect when you book with a reputable broker like Sakaem Logistics.



First, it's important to understand the difference between brokers and carriers. A broker is a middleman who connects you with actual carriers—the companies that physically transport your vehicle. When you call a broker like Sakaem Logistics for a car shipping quote, we use our AI-verified pricing engine to provide transparent, assignment-ready quotes. We then match you with FMCSA-licensed carriers who have excellent reviews and full insurance coverage. This protects you throughout the entire process.



Here's how the process unfolds: After you receive your quote and book your shipment, the broker finds an available carrier. The carrier then schedules a pickup time at your Parker location. Before pickup day, clear all personal items from your vehicle and ensure it has about a quarter tank of gas—enough for loading and unloading. The carrier will inspect your car and document its condition. Your vehicle must be in running condition and able to roll onto the transport trailer. For high-end or classic vehicles, request an enclosed trailer for extra protection during transit.



Once your car is picked up, the carrier transports it to your destination. You'll have real-time tracking so you know where your vehicle is at all times. Upon delivery, the carrier will contact you to schedule the final drop-off. Payment is typically due at pickup or delivery—Sakaem Logistics requires no upfront deposits. After delivery, inspect your car and compare its condition to the initial inspection report.
